Essam Abdallah Ibrahim Mubaideen (Arabic: عصام عبد الله ابراهيم مبيضين, born 15 June 1986) is a Jordanian footballer.
International career
Essam's first match with the Jordan national senior team was against Belarus in an international friendly held on 21 March 2013 in Amman, which resulted in a 1–0 victory for Jordan.
